## Deployment

Heads up for reviewers: the Brindleware component library ships as versioned bundles, and consumers pin a major version — we never hot-swap minors under them without a changelog entry. Releases are built in an isolated pipeline and signed before publish. If you're auditing what actually goes out the door, the publish job reads everything from the config below.

config for hahif-yadug:
oliael:
  log_level: warn
  metrics_host: metrics.oliael.zemvarsys.internal
  pool_size: 8

Onboarding note: the Marloft orders table uses soft deletes. Rows get a `deleted_at` timestamp; nothing is ever hard-deleted in prod. All read paths must filter on `deleted_at IS NULL` — the ORM scope does this, raw SQL does not. Release managers: any migration touching this table needs the purge job paused first, or the nightly reaper will race your schema change. That has burned us twice. Verify the pause flag in pre-release checks. The purge-job pause procedure is documented on the internal page below.

dashboard of bafof-hafog = https://confluence.lumiclabs.internal/display/browse/display/6a09a20a

**FAQ: Why are tables partitioned by month?**

Monthly partitions keep the Lanternfold ledger tables small enough for the nightly vacuum window. Release manager drops partitions older than 18 months during each quarterly release; do not drop the current or previous month. Partition creation is automated, but the December rollover occasionally needs a manual kick. If the partition admin tool locks you out mid-release, use the break-glass account rather than waiting for on-call. Its recovery passphrase is listed directly below this entry.

vault phrase of bagaf-kajeg = jorath-feniel-briir-siliel-ralix

**Vendor note: Inkmill markdown pipeline**

Rendering for Parchway docs is outsourced to Inkmill under an annual contract, renewing each March. They handle sanitization and PDF export; we own the upload queue. SLA: 4-hour response on rendering failures. Escalate only after two failed retries. Their support desk is reachable at the address below.

billing contact of hahaf-baguf = zorael.tammir.jorius@sivrelhq.internal